Toyota Tundra - Headrest & Visor Video
This customer is getting his Toyota Tundra ready for a road trip with the family. Traffic Jamz installed a video screen for each member of the family. The two kids each have their own 7" video monitors. Each monitor is equip with an independent DVD player. No more fights about which movie to watch. The 5 year old boy can watch his Transformers movie while the 4 year old girl can watch one of her Disney princess movies. Each of the kids has wireless headphones. The headphones were upgraded for 2 channel reception for those times when both kids can agree on the same movie.
The wife(passenger) also got her own screen up front. This is a 12" widescreen monitor with its own DVD source. This monitor replaces the passenger visor. The picture quality on all these monitors is great! The whole family will enjoy their road trip and no one will ask "Are we there yet?"

1965 Buick Riviera - Chopped Top
One of the most beautiful cars we've seen! This vintage Riviera has been meticulously restored. It came to Traffic Jamz for an audio installation. The customer wanted to retain the factory look on the dash, so we installed an aftermarket Kenwood CD player in the glove box. An IR repeater was installed to allow for remote control of the CD player while the glove box is closed. The CD player came equipped with Ipod control and Ipod charging. Overall, a fantastic vintage car with a modern sound system.

Audi A8 - NAV-TV and Smoked Tail Lights
Nice Car! The smoked tail lights make it look HOT!!! Smoking the tail lights is a several layer process, untill the desire darkness is achieved. This customer also wanted to integrate a backup camera and aftermarket DVD player to play movies on his factory NAV screen. We are able to mount an aftermarket DVD player in the glove box right next to the factory nav system.
With a NAV-TV high quality multi-purpose backup camera interface we were able to turn this customers factory navigation screen into a backup camera, a movie screen and more! This interface also allows for Video in Motion and Audio/Video (i.e. ipod) control on the factory screen.

Police Scanner installed in Chevy Tahoe
This vehicle can into Traffic Jamz to fix an installed done else where. Traffic Jamz fixed the wiring on this customer's Kenwood double din navigation unit. The Viper 2-way alarm/remote start was not working so Traffic Jamz went through all the wiring and found the main problem to be a crushed relay pack. This customer was so happy with Traffic Jamz's problem solving skills and workmanship that he felt confident to have Traffic Jamz install a police scanner. We custom flush mounted the police scanner on the lower dash, below the navigation unit and the heater controls. The antenna was mounted on the driver's side rear window.
